If you are planning on hiring a vehicle for the first time, you should use the below tips to minimise your rental expenses.
Insist on the Basic Package There are different rental packages that you can choose when hiring a vehicle. In some cases, they are beneficial because they incorporate multiple add-ons which would cost more if purchased separately. However, if you are working with a small budget, they might increase your costs unnecessarily. Therefore, you should choose the basic rental package without additional features or services included. If you are interested in one of the special packages, you should ask for a cost breakdown so that you can calculate the value.
Choose a Designated Driver You should avoid having multiple drivers handling your rental vehicle. In simple terms, you should choose one driver for the trip if you are travelling in a group. Typically, if you register an additional driver for the rental car, the hire company will charge a standard fee for each of the individuals. The charge is intended to cover the extra insurance expenses. Therefore, you should decide on the driver as early as possible.
Use Navigation Applications Driving in a new area can be challenging. Therefore, most car rental companies offer satellite navigation options with their vehicles at an additional cost. These devices are handy for providing reliable directions around the area of interest. Regrettably, the fee attached to this feature can be high and will increase your total expense significantly. Therefore, you should consider using a smartphone navigation application for maps.
Check the Car Condition Finally, you should check the condition of your vehicle before signing the rental agreement. This inspection process should help you identify any blemishes and scratches which might have been caused by past users. If the details are included in the rental contract, there will be no source of disagreement or unexpected damage charges.
